2023 Call for PhD Studentships – Regular Line of Application
PhD studentships are intended to finance the development of research activities by the studentship holder, that allow obtaining a PhD degree.
Overview and objectives

Within the scope of the pursuit of a public policy for advanced training based on research with social relevance, the Fundação para a Ciência e a Tecnologia, I.P. (FCT) opens a Call for granting PhD studentships complying with the provisions of the FCT Regulation for Studentships and Fellowships (RBI) and the Research Fellowship Holder Statute, according to the respective current versions. In this regular line of application of the call for PhD Studentships, applications are accepted in all scientific areas and with research work to be carried out in scientific and academic institutions. A specific line of application is also open in this call for PhD studentships in which work plans are partially carried out in one or more non-academic entities (for further details, consult the page dedicated to this line of funding).

Who can apply

PhD studentships in the regular line of application are aimed at applicants enrolled or that comply with the requirements to enrol for PhD studies and who wish to carry out research towards this degree in any academic entity of production and dissemination of knowledge, national or international, including public and private higher education institutions, R&D units, Associated Laboratories, as well as other private non-profit institutions mainly developing R&D activities.

Evaluation

Evaluation of applications is performed by evaluation panels comprising experts with recognized experience and scientific merit. Applications are graded from zero (0.00, minimum) to five (5.00, maximum) in three evaluation criteria:

A. Merit of the Applicant;

B. Merit of the Work Plan;

C. Merit of the Hosting Conditions.

The relative weights of three criteria are 30%, 40%, 30%, respectively.

The merit of the applicant is evaluated based on two sub-criteria: academic career, with a relative weight of 50% and personal curriculum, also with a relative weight of 50%.

Applicant’s personal curriculum is analysed in an integrated manner, considering a global view of scientific and professional achievements.

Assessment of the work plan and of the host institution conditions is based on a duly substantiated assessment decision by the review panel.

Applications will be ranked according to the weighted average of the score obtained in the three evaluation criteria, and in the following order of precedence, for tie-breaking purposes: criterion B (Merit of the Work Plan), criterion A (Merit of the Applicant) and criterion C (Merit of the Hosting Conditions);

Applicants whose application is scored with a final grade lower than 3.000 are not eligible for studentship granting.

The procedures regarding the evaluation of applications must be consulted in the Evaluation Guide.

Funding

Selected applicants will have monthly allowances and supplementary support, according to the established in the Regulation (RBI), which may include tuition fees, support for complementary training activities or presentation of work at scientific meetings, personal accident insurance and, when applicable, travel and relocation costs.

The studentships granted in this call will be financed by FCT using the State Budget fund and, whenever eligible, using the European Social Fund (ESF), under the Programa Demografia, Qualificações e Inclusão (PDQI), according to the respective requirements.
